<<<<<<<<<<<<< DARK FORCES ADD-ON MISSION >>>>>>>>>>>>>> BOBA FETT'S REVENGE >>>>>>> VERSION 2 <<<<<<< This zipfile consists of 4 files - BFREVNGE.TXT (this file) BFREVNGE.GOB (main Dark Forces data file) BFREVNGE.BAT (batch file to start the new mission) BFREVNGE.LFD (has new DF mission briefings) Directions: UnZip < BFREVNGE.ZIP > and copy the files to your Dark Forces directory < i.e. C:\DARK >. Then switch to that directory and type < BFREVNGE >. The mission briefings are now displayed inside Dark Forces itself. The file BFREVNGE.LFD is renamed DFBRIEF.LFD while the game is running; if the game crashes for some reason, you must restore this file back to its original name to restore the original mission briefings. NOTE TO MACINTOSH USERS : Due to a slight difference in behavior between the PC and Mac versions of Dark Forces, this level probably will not play correctly on a Mac. The problem occurs when Kyle recovers his gear. On the PC, Kyles current inventory is MERGED with his other gear. It has been reported to me that on the Mac, Kyles previous gear REPLACES his current inventory. In this level, this will leave you stranded in a locked room because the key that got you into that room will have disappeared from your inventory. If you don't collect Kyles gear you will be unable to finish the level.
